Description The Western States Energy & Environment Symposium convened at Teton Village in Jackson Hole, Wyoming from October 25-27, 2009. The Symposium was sponsored by the State of Wyoming as authorized by the Wyoming Legislature in House Bill No. 295. HB 295 established a steering committee to guide the planning of the symposium and charged the University of Wyoming, School of Energy Resources with conducting the symposium at the direction of the steering committee. The bill also authorized legislative participation in the planning process, required a report after the symposium, and provided appropriations in support of the process.
